Security Engineer II

 

The Security Engineer II will focus on the application of engineering principles to the design, implementation, and maintenance of security measures to protect an organization's information systems and data. These roles involve assessing vulnerabilities, developing security protocols, security monitoring and incident response, security development lifecycle activities, enterprise identity governance and administration, platform deployment and management and deploying technologies to safeguard against cyber threats, ensuring the integrity, confidentiality, and availability of information assets.

 

The Security Engineer II plays a critical role in supporting security solutions across the enterprise. This position is a second level role requiring an expanded foundational understanding of security engineering and software development practices to support security initiatives, ensuring secure architecture for workloads, and learning industry best practices. This person will complete testing or troubleshooting work to protect the organization’s technology environments and respond to emerging threats, vulnerabilities, and compliance requirements.

Required Knowledge and Skills

  • Broad, practical knowledge of securing cloud platforms such as public cloud providers

  • Advanced knowledge of cloud-native security services

  • Broad, practical knowledge of compliance standards such as ISO 27001, NIST, CIS, GDPR, and SOC2, and experience implementing governance policies

  • Broad, practical knowledge of security architecture principles and best practices, particularly in network defense, endpoint security, and cloud security

  • Broad, practical knowledge of cloud security services and tools like IAM, encryption, network security, firewalls, and logging/monitoring solutions

  • Familiar with common cloud security tools, able to automate straightforward tasks, and begins to identify areas for improvement in security processes by incorporating simple automation

  • Broad, practical knowledge of firewalls, intrusion detection/prevention systems (IDS/IPS), and endpoint protection solutions

  • Familiar with key regulatory frameworks, able to independently align security activities with compliance requirements, and supports audits with minimal guidance

  • Broad, practical knowledge of cloud network security and encryption methodologies

  • Able to provide assistance to cross-functional teams in risk management, incident response, and compliance activities

  • Strong communication skills, with the ability to communicate information that may involve explanation or interpretation within the department

  • Ability to think critically and make risk-based decisions in high-pressure environments

  • Working knowledge of conducting vendor security assessments and able to identify standard security risks in vendor contracts

  • Able to analyze and assess straightforward risks and recognize common incident patterns

  • Capable of identifying common new threats, applying updated practices with some guidance, and adjusting response strategies in familiar scenarios with limited supervision

  • Broad, practical understanding of Privilege Management, Application Control, Antivirus, Endpoint Detection and Response, File Integrity Monitoring, Intrusion Detection/Prevention Systems, logging/monitoring, and other commonly implemented enterprise security technologies

  • Broad, practical knowledge of network protocols such as TCP/IP, DNS, HTTP/HTTPS, BGP, OSPF, and SNMP
